Hypersonic "Zircon" carrier frigate "Marshal Shaposhnikov" to demonstrate the power of the Russian fleet at DIMDEX-2026

Project 1155M ship open for visits in Doha port

As part of the 9th Doha International Maritime Defence Exhibition and Conference (DIMDEX-2026), held in Doha from January 19 to 22, the multi-purpose frigate "Marshal Shaposhnikov" of the Pacific Fleet of the Russian Navy was presented to the general public. The ship arrived at Hamad Port, where, along with warships from Kuwait, Oman, Saudi Arabia, and France, it became the central element of the maritime exposition.

The official opening of the forum took place on January 19 at the Qatar National Convention Centre under the chairmanship of Emir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ani. Later that day, delegations of foreign naval forces inspected the arriving ships, including the Russian frigate. From January 20 to 22, all exhibited ships, including "Marshal Shaposhnikov", will be open for free visits.

The armament of the frigate "Marshal Shaposhnikov", modernized under Project 1155M, aroused particular interest among specialists. The ship is equipped with 16 universal vertical launch systems (VLS) for "Caliber" cruise missiles, "Onyx" anti-ship missiles, and "Zircon" hypersonic missiles, as well as "Otvet" anti-submarine missiles.

Air defense is provided by 64 cells for the "Kinzhal" missile system. The artillery armament includes a 100-mm universal gun A-190, four 30-mm anti-aircraft guns AK-630, as well as anti-submarine weapons - two four-tube 533-mm torpedo tubes and two RBU-6000 rocket launchers.

In total, the event involves more than 200 companies and over 130 official delegations from around the world.
